Coming to The Galleries at CSU: Beyond Borders, The Art of Siona Benjamin

The identity of Indian-American-Jewish artist Siona Benjamin is layered and multifaceted, just like her artwork. Cleveland State University is pleased to present Beyond Borders: The Art of Siona Benjamin, a solo exhibition featuring over forty works engaging themes of immigration, gender, the concept of “home,” and the role of art in social change.
